Visit www.navigant.com.Navigant's Life Sciences practice works with pharmaceutical and biotechnology clients to address a wide range of business issues including market analyses, strategy development and business planning. Projects include: portfolio/franchise/brand strategy, new product planning, pricing and reimbursement strategies; life cycle management; and technology acquisition evaluation.Responsibilities:This is a highly challenging position that draws heavily upon all of the analytical, creative, and interpersonal skills essential to effective general strategy consulting. The ability to provide comprehensive and diverse support for consulting engagements is essential. Our consultants must organize their own tasks and schedules in carrying out substantial business analyses and delivering high quality, client-ready work. As our clients are often large, complex systems, these consultants must demonstrate considerable poise and business maturity to perform effectively and add value in the client environment. .Specific responsibilities include:* Performs data research, collection and analysis, report preparation and other related tasks* Learns and applies appropriate tools, methodologies and quality control procedures* May have limited client interaction* Completes work independently and within a team settingQualifications:· Graduating with an undergraduate or masters degree between December 2012 and August 2013 and are majoring in business, economics, science, engineering or other technical disciplines· Demonstrated interest in the Life Sciences· Should exhibit a strong academic performance, knowledge of Word, Excel and PowerPoint, and the ability to research and analyze information· Exhibit critical thinking, and oral and written communication skill· Problem solving skills, a high level of motivation, and excellent organizational skills are also required· Have ability to work autonomously and have strong time and project management skills· Must demonstrate willingness to travel and work overtime when requiredThe company offers competitive compensation packages including an incentive compensation plan, comprehensive medical/dental/life insurance, 401(k) and employee stock purchase plans.Navigant does not accept unsolicited resumes through or from search firms or staffing agencies.
